This study investigates the effects of non-pharmaceutical interventions (NPIs) on the viral spectrum and seasonal dynamics of acute respiratory tract infections (ARTIs) in children, with a particular focus on post-NPI data. The analysis compares viral detection rates and seasonal patterns post-NPI with those observed during the pre-NPI and NPI periods, as previously published. We performed a retrospective analysis of 93,852 pediatric cases of ARTIs from 2018 to 2024 at the Third Affiliated Hospital of Zhengzhou University.

The active structural change of actin cytoskeleton is a general host response upon pathogen attack. This study characterized the function of the cotton (Gossypium hirsutum) actin-binding protein VILLIN2 (GhVLN2) in host defense against the soilborne fungus Verticillium dahliae. Biochemical analysis demonstrated that GhVLN2 possessed actin-binding, -bundling, and -severing activities.

Objective: This study aimed to investigate the gender difference in anxiety in novel coronavirus pneumonia (COVID-19) patients in the quarantine ward during the outbreak.

Methods: The self-rating anxiety scale (SAS) was used on the seventh day of isolation to analyze the anxiety levels of a total of 242 suspected or confirmed COVID-19 patients in the quarantine wards of two hospitals; 232 of these patients (112 males and 120 females) completed the anxiety scoring. The anxiety scores were compared between male and female patients using the -test, and a scatter diagram was used for analysis.

Auxin response factors (ARFs) play central roles in conferring auxin-mediated responses through selection of target genes in plants. Despite their physiological importance, systematic analysis of ARF genes in potato have not been investigated yet. Our genome-wide analysis identified 20 StARF (Solanum tuberosum ARF) genes from potato and found that they are unevenly distributed in all the potato chromosomes except chromosome X.
